What are common challenges faced by TREC license holders in maintaining compliance, and how can they effectively manage these responsibilities?

TREC license holders often face challenges in keeping up with ongoing education requirements, staying informed about regulatory updates, and maintaining accurate records for audits. To effectively manage these responsibilities, it's important to set reminders for renewal deadlines, regularly review communications from TREC, and utilize digital tools for document organization. Collaborating with colleagues or joining professional associations can also help in sharing best practices and staying compliant.

What is a TREC?

Trec jobs typically refer to positions related to the Texas Real Estate Commission (TREC), which oversees the licensing and regulation of real estate professionals in Texas. Roles may include administrative, legal, compliance, or licensing positions within the organization or related industries. Employees help ensure real estate transactions are conducted legally and ethically, and provide support for licensees and consumers. These jobs require a strong understanding of real estate laws, regulations, and procedures in Texas.
